    Ok...the hard drive that was in the laptop was an IBM Travelstar 4200 RPM 40 GB.  I put in a Seagate 5400 RPM 80 GB.  My laptop is an HP ze5170.  I've reformatted the new hard drive and reinstalled the OS twice now with the same results.  I replaced the original one because it crashed.
